Over past three months staff shortages have caused long lineups at airports and flight delays and cancellations

“Despite detailed and careful planning, the largest and fastest scale of hiring in our history, as well as investments in aircraft and equipment, it is now clear that Air Canada’s operations too have been disrupted by the industry’s complex and unavoidable challenges,” Rousseau said.

Since provincial governments across the country began lifting pandemic-era restrictions, the aviation industry has been hit by heavy demand that’s left airlines and airports unable to keep up. Reports of long passenger lineups at airport security; insufficient staff to help with boarding and de-boarding; and flight delays or cancellations have plagued the industry for the past three months.

International flights will not be impacted, the airline said, but rather four routes will be temporarily be suspended this summer. They include between Montreal and the cities of Baltimore and Kelowna, and one between Toronto to Fort McMurray.
